How Stress Impacts Your Liver Health
The Stress Response
When you’re stressed, your body releases cortisol and adrenaline, which can trigger inflammation and impact how your liver functions.
Inflammation Overload
Stress increases oxidative stress and inflammation, which can worsen conditions like fatty liver, especially when combined with poor lifestyle habits.
Stress-Driven Behaviors
Chronic stress can lead to alcohol use, overeating, and poor sleep all of which burden your liver over time.
Metabolic Impact
Stress can worsen insulin resistance and fat accumulation, both of which contribute to non-alcoholic fatty liver disease (NAFLD).
Manage Stress
Practices like meditation, exercise, deep breathing, and good sleep can reduce stress and support liver function naturally.
If you have liver issues and chronic stress, consult a healthcare provider to manage both physical and emotional health together.
